What Exactly is This High-Performance Resinous Shield?
You might have seen those cheap DIY paint kits at the hardware store, but those thin water-based paints usually peel up the second your hot car tires park on them. On the flip side, we use a true two-part chemical mix that creates a massive molecular bond with your prepared concrete. This chemical reaction creates a thick, impenetrable shell that can take a beating from heavy trucks, dropped wrenches, and messy chemical spills.
Because the secret lies in the preparation, we never just slap the product on top of dirty concrete. First, we use heavy diamond grinders to open up the pores of your slab, which ensures the liquid resin sinks deep into the concrete before curing. Consequently, your new surface will never bubble, peel, or lift, even under intense daily abuse.

Why Mountain Homes Need Serious Slab Protection
Living up in the scenic Plumas County area means we get some pretty wild weather, from freezing winter snow to scorching summer heat. This constant temperature bouncing causes concrete to expand and contract, which leads to annoying cracks and crumbling if moisture gets trapped inside. By sealing your floor with our waterproof polymer, you block moisture from ever getting down into those tiny pores.
On top of that, winter roads mean your car brings home a nasty mix of road salt, de-icing chemicals, and melting snow. These harsh elements will eat away at bare concrete, leaving you with dusty, pitted floors that look terrible. Installing our heavy-duty shield means you can just wash those winter chemicals away with a simple garden hose.

The Step-by-Step Way We Transform Your Space
First, we start by checking your concrete for dampness and cleaning up any old oil spots that might ruin the bond. Next, our crew runs a dustless diamond grinding machine over the entire surface to rough it up to the perfect texture. This step is super dusty if you do it yourself, but our professional vacuum systems keep your home clean.
After the grinding is done, we patch every single crack and divot with a super-strong patching compound so the floor is perfectly flat. Then, we apply the base primer coat, scatter your choice of decorative color flakes, and seal it all in with a crystal-clear topcoat. This final topcoat gives you a brilliant shine while adding a slip-resistant texture so you do not slide around when it gets wet.

Epoxy floor coating in Twain, California
Property owners in Twain, California usually call after looking at a bare concrete slab that is dusting, staining, or simply old. Epoxy floor coating is a multi-coat resin system applied directly over a prepared slab. The chemistry bonds at a molecular level with the concrete and cures into a rigid, chemical-resistant surface several times harder than the slab beneath.
Most modern systems are 80 to 100 mil thick once cured. The visual hallmark is a glossy mirror finish, often with decorative flake or metallic. Beyond the look, the slab is now sealed: motor oil, brake fluid, road salt and acid spills wipe off instead of soaking in.

How much does epoxy flooring cost in Twain, California?
Residential garages typically run $4 to $10 per square foot installed, depending on finish complexity and prep needed. A two-car garage usually lands between $1,800 and $4,500. The phone quote is firm before any deposit is taken.
How long does the coating last?
A properly prepped professional-grade install lasts 15 to 25 years in residential garage use. heavy-traffic floors are warrantied for 10 years. The 5-year written warranty covers adhesion and chip-out from the slab.
